In the 1980s, a private social center called the "Brothers' House" operated in Busan, South Korea.

It was used to collect homeless people, orphans, and people with disabilities — part of a campaign to "clean up" the streets before the 1988 Seoul Olympics.

Officially, the facility was supposed to help those in need — providing food, shelter, and support. In reality, it was a concentration camp with brutal and inhumane conditions.

Inside, there were beatings, torture, murder, forced labor, and even human trafficking. Some accounts mention horrific “games” organized by staff — sometimes for the entertainment of high-profile guests.

Between 1975 and 1986, between 513 and 657 people died at that facility, according to various reports.
